Output 21e40981109b73f88e032e601c916687032880dfaef25a104d42ab60d0ab3c5c:1

value
264085
script pubkey
OP_0 OP_PUSHBYTES_20 fbbbaf64f9a3adbef3b74ac721a160ee4e9dbdaa
address
ltc1qlwa67e8e5wkmauahftrjrgtqae8fm0d2j3kp73
transaction
21e40981109b73f88e032e601c916687032880dfaef25a104d42ab60d0ab3c5c
spent
true